Chuck Norris Meets And Greets Fans In College Station
Norris was on hand to sign his book, The Official Chuck Norris Fact Book.

Hundreds of fans lined up at Scripture Haven in the Post Oak Mall Monday night to meet superstar actor Chuck Norris.
Norris was on hand signing copies of his book, "The Official Chuck Norris Fact Book."
The book tells the true stories behind sayings like, "When Chuck Norris does push-ups, he isn't pushing himself up. He's pushing the earth down." or "Chuck Norris can kill two stones with one bird."
Norris was scheduled to be at the mall for just two hours, but as of 9:30 p.m. Monday night he was still there signing books for those who have been in line since early in the evening.
"It's such an honor, it's so hard to describe. I can't really define how I feel in my heart that these people still look up to me," said Norris.
News 3's Shane McAuliffe will have more on Norris and his plans to bring his Kickstart program to the Brazos Valley Tuesday on KBTX News 3.
